Transaction 837fc8ce434638a764037b246b307734ce414b238b695669e032bb5a76c34686
1 Input
1 Output
-
837fc8ce434638a764037b246b307734ce414b238b695669e032bb5a76c34686:0
- value
- 1105489
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c15bd082ba0672683dcfa6ca5ad594e7d8cdc8d
- address
- bc1qls2m6zpt5pnjdq7ulfk2tt2efe7cehydcf06pk